North Strand Road
16 sales have been filed on the Property Price Register for North Strand Road since 2012, at a median of €240,000.
They ran from €40,000 to €425,000. 1 of them were new builds.

Why this street and not others
A street gets a page once at least 5 sales have been recorded on it. Below that a median is a handful of anecdotes rather than a figure, and a page saying so would be worse than no page.
Source: Property Services Regulatory Authority, used under the Creative Commons Attribution 4.0 licence. Sales that were not at arm’s length are excluded throughout.
